Abstract: This paper presents PAVES, a direct manipulation
system that combines aspects of visualization and multimedia
systems to form an interactive video programming
environment. PAVES extends the VuSystem media
processing toolkit with dataflow-style views for controlling
compute-intensive media applications as they
run. Thus video may be manipulated graphically and
interactively --- both program and data are visual and
live. PAVES is also novel in its approach to extensibility.
